Deceased Estate Clearance is a service that lots of Sydney households never ever anticipate to need until they suddenly do, often within days of a funeral service when practical matters begin pressing in together with grief that has hardly had time to settle. A home that as soon as felt full of life can quickly become a source of stress once the truth embeds in that every wardrobe, cupboard and drawer needs to be gone through, arranged and ultimately cleared. What makes Deceased Estate Clearance various from a normal move or restoration clean-out is the weight brought by even the most common objects, because a cracked teacup or an old cardigan may hold more indicating to a grieving relative than any important piece of furniture in the room. Sydney households increasingly turn to expert clearance specialists not merely to remove belongings, however to have somebody experienced guide them through a process that can otherwise feel paralysing when approached alone.

The timing of a Deceased Estate Clearance frequently has a surprisingly outsized effect, a fact numerous households discover just after they start dealing with lawyers, executors, and real‑estate agents. While probate might take months to conclude, a house often has to be readied for sale well before the legal matters are totally settled, forcing a mindful balancing act between honoring the family's need for time and meeting external due dates such as settlement or listing dates. A knowledgeable Deceased Estate Clearance service discovers to run in the middle of this uncertainty, staying adaptable sufficient to halt work when loved ones require extra time to select what to keep, yet staying prepared to act promptly when approval is granted. This versatility is crucial for administrators who are often get more info balancing multiple responsibilities, and it can be the choosing aspect in between a clearance that adds to their problem and one that really relieves their load throughout a currently difficult duration.

Multi-generational homes provide a specific challenge within Deceased Estate Clearance work, especially in parts of Sydney where households have lived in the very same residential or commercial property for several generations before ultimately passing it down or selling it. In these cases, a single home may contain not just one life time of valuables, however layers of built up products from moms and dads, grandparents and even previously loved ones, each with their own story attached. Arranging through decades of inherited furniture, old pictures, letters and mementos requires a slower, more considered pace than a basic family clearance, and family members frequently desire the chance to look through boxes themselves before anything is removed. A knowledgeable Deceased Estate Clearance group acknowledges this and develops sufficient flexibility into their procedure to accommodate family involvement, instead of dealing with the job as an easy strip-and-clear exercise that ignores the deeper history embedded in the home.

Practical considerations around disposal stay just as important throughout this procedure, even amidst its psychological complexity. Reputable Sydney companies make a point of separating functional furnishings, clothing and family products for donation to local charities, guaranteeing these products find an authentic second use instead of being discarded unnecessarily. Products such as wood, metal and cardboard are arranged for recycling wherever possible, reducing the ecological footprint of what can often be a very large clearance task. For families who may worry about just throwing away a liked one's personal belongings, understanding that a Deceased Estate Clearance service provider deals with disposal thoughtfully uses a little however meaningful sense of comfort, changing what could seem like an act of erasure into something better to a considered, respectful transition.
